Trumpet Vine (Zones 4-9) If you’re looking for a full sun, heat-tolerant, drought-tolerant, flowering vine, consider trumpet vine, also known as trumpet creeper ( Campsis radicans ). Often confused with honeysuckle by non-gardeners, trumpet creepers are native to the southeastern United States, it can grow to a total height of 25-40 feet ... The mid-south, USDA Zone 7, is characterized by mild winters, hot and humid summers, and a long growing season. Many perennials, shrubs, and vines are hardy to Zone 7 and have no trouble getting through the winter. However, they are challenged when summer brings a moist, humid atmosphere yet …

USDA … how to show iphone screen on macbookWebPeonies are hardy to Zone 3 and grow well as far south as Zones 7 and 8. In most of the U.S., the rules for success are simple: provide full sun and well-drained soil. Peonies even relish cold winters, because they need chilling for bud formation. ...
